Transaction 893a7d6eeeea7d11a13a08f0f2e36ead64c1da3ec5173a407f250971d413a390
2 Input
2 Outputs
- 893a7d6eeeea7d11a13a08f0f2e36ead64c1da3ec5173a407f250971d413a390:0
- 893a7d6eeeea7d11a13a08f0f2e36ead64c1da3ec5173a407f250971d413a390:1
value 2860000
address 3CH2SuHowDzQEpWSC2tDcLgoPHHt8dxYRz
value 100876
address 1A5ehPU5W3VxkuvKWLSyYdAfK2YMdsJiaq